Le Creuset 70712200099171 34 Oz. French Press in Riviera
Making great-tasting coffee at home is refreshingly simple with the Le Creuset Riviera French Press, model 70712200099171. Add coarsely ground coffee beans or loose tea leaves, steep them in boiling water, then lower the mesh sieve through the press to filter the brew. With a 34 fl. oz. capacity, this stoneware French press offers an easy way to prepare and serve favorite hot drinks at home.
Premium stoneware gives the press excellent heat retention, helping coffee or tea stay warm when it is time to pour. Its vibrant Riviera glaze brings beautiful color to the kitchen while providing a durable surface for everyday use. The finish is non-porous and non-reactive, so it resists absorbed flavors that could carry from one brew to the next. Resistance to chips, scratches and stains also helps preserve the press's colorful appearance through regular preparation and serving.
Le Creuset combines colorful styling with practical care for a French press that fits comfortably into a daily coffee or tea routine. The virtually non-stick glazed surface supports quick cleanup, while dishwasher-safe construction makes care even more convenient. It also resists cracking and crazing, pairing lasting utility with thoughtful details that help make the brewing process easier. From steeping a morning coffee to serving loose-leaf tea, this Riviera press brings premium stoneware and distinctive color to a simple, time-honored preparation method.

Footnotes:
Each item in the Le Creuset stoneware range is hand-crafted, so slight variations may occur from piece to piece.
Before first use, wash the stoneware in hot, soapy water, then rinse and dry it thoroughly.
Do not use Le Creuset stoneware on the stovetop or any other direct heat source. It is safe for the microwave, freezer, refrigerator, dishwasher, oven and broiler, with a maximum oven-safe temperature of 500 degrees F / 260 degrees C. Always use oven mitts when lifting.

The 10-year limited stoneware warranty covers faulty workmanship or materials under normal domestic use when care and use instructions are followed. It excludes normal wear and tear, accidents, misuse, abuse, commercial use, and certain cosmetic or overheating damage. Coverage begins on the original owner's purchase date.
